PVDF Cartridge Filters: Chemical Resistance and High Durability

PVDF component are widely recognized for their exceptional endurance to a broad spectrum of chemicals. Constructed from polyvinylidene difluoride (PVDF), these filters exhibit remarkable durability, making them ideal for demanding applications where exposure to corrosive substances is inevitable. The highly tight nature of PVDF provides a robust barrier against chemical attack, ensuring consistent filtration performance even in harsh environments. This chemical resiliency, coupled with their high robustness, makes PVDF cartridge filters a preferred choice in various industries, including pharmaceuticals, manufacturing.

High-Grade PTFE Cartridges for Sensitive Use

PTFE filter cartridges are renowned for their exceptional ability to provide ultra-fine filtration in demanding applications. Constructed from polytetrafluoroethylene (PTFE), these cartridges offer a robust barrier against particulate matter, ensuring the highest levels of purity and cleanliness. Their chemical inertness and resistant to a wide range of chemicals, making them suitable for diverse industries including pharmaceuticals, biotechnology. The special properties of PTFE result in low extractables, minimizing the risk of contamination. With their high flow rates and long service life, PTFE filter cartridges are an ideal choice for critical processes where exactness is paramount.

Increase Cartridge Filter Life

Maintaining a stable flow of clean water is essential for countless applications. To ensure your cartridge filters perform at their peak, implementing techniques to extend their lifespan is crucial. Regular inspection and cleaning are fundamental steps. Carefully examine the filter media for clogging, and rinse it according to the manufacturer’s advice.

Furthermore, governing water flow rate can reduce strain on the filter. Ensure that pre-filters are working to capture larger particles before they reach the cartridge filter. Additionally, consider implementing a cleaning cycle periodically to dispose of trapped impurities.

  • Selecting for high-quality, durable filters from reputable distributors is a wise investment.
  • Tracking pressure differentials across the filter can provide valuable insights into its quality. A significant increase indicates sediment build-up, requiring immediate attention.

By adhering to these best practices, you can significantly improve the lifespan of your cartridge filters, ensuring a continuous supply of clean water and enhancing their effectiveness.
